Jogging routes around Kreis Kleve benefit from the region's predominantly flat terrain, making it suitable for various fitness levels. The landscape features extensive forest areas, including the Reichswald, and picturesque riverine paths along the Rhine and Niers. Numerous nature reserves and green spaces offer tranquil backdrops for running, providing diverse scenery and fresh air.

Kreis Kleve offers a vast network of over 1,800 running routes, catering to various preferences and fitness levels. You'll find everything from easy, short jogs to more challenging, longer runs.
Yes, Kreis Kleve is ideal for beginners and casual joggers due to its predominantly flat terrain, especially in the Lower Rhine region. There are over 230 easy routes available. A good option is the Running loop from Kreis Kleve, which is 2.9 miles (4.6 km) and leads through varied green spaces.
For those seeking a greater challenge, Kreis Kleve features nearly 200 difficult routes. The Brandenberg Summit – Freilenberg Summit loop from Reichswald is a demanding 21.3 km (13.2 miles) trail with significant elevation gain, offering a robust workout. Another option is the Krickenbeck Lake Docks loop from Niederdorf, which spans nearly 20 km.
Many of the running routes in Kreis Kleve are designed as circular loops,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. For example, the Running loop from Hau is a moderate 7.8 km (4.8 miles) circular route, and the Running loop from Pfalzdorf offers a 10.5 km (6.5 miles) circular experience.
You'll encounter diverse natural landscapes, including extensive forest areas like the Reichswald, picturesque riverine paths along the Rhine and Niers, and numerous tranquil nature reserves. The region's 66 protected areas, such as the Düffel Nature Reserve, provide unspoiled floodplains and rich bird habitats, offering beautiful backdrops for your run.
Absolutely! Many routes combine exercise with sightseeing. For instance, the Bensdorp Chocolate Factory – Kleve Zoo loop from Kleve passes by local attractions. You can also find routes that lead past cultural sights like the historic city wall and watchtowers in Rees, or along the scenic Emmerich on the Rhine Promenade.
The running routes in Kreis Kleve are highly regarded by the komoot community, boasting an average rating of 4.4 stars from over 800 reviews. More than 15,000 runners have explored the varied terrain, often praising the well-maintained paths and the serene natural beauty.
Yes, the predominantly flat terrain and numerous green spaces make many routes family-friendly. Look for easy-rated, shorter loops that offer accessible paths, often found within urban parks or along river dikes, providing a pleasant experience for all ages.
Many trails in Kreis Kleve are suitable for running with dogs, especially those through forest areas like the Reichswald or along the Rhine dikes. It's always advisable to keep your dog on a leash, especially in nature reserves, and to check local regulations for specific areas.
Yes, many popular running routes and trailheads in Kreis Kleve offer convenient parking options. Routes starting from towns or well-known natural areas often have designated parking lots nearby, making access easy for runners.
The region is rich in riverine landscapes, offering beautiful runs along the Rhine and Niers rivers. The View of the Old Rhine loop from Rees is a moderate 9 km (5.6 miles) route that provides scenic views along the river. Running along the Rheindeich (Rhine dike) is also a popular choice for calming, picturesque jogs.
Even within urban areas, Kreis Kleve offers beautiful green spaces for jogging. Kleve itself features expansive parks and historic gardens like the Forest Garden and Moritz Park, which have idyllic designs, picturesque water features, and shady avenues perfect for leisurely runs. The "Kermisdahl route" connects city history with nature, passing through Prince Moritz Park.
